Description

This book is about your capacity to love; to be amazed and astonished. It's about the unacknowledged grace that you possess. It concerns your native potential to create. You are wiser, more compassionate and of greater use than, in many cases, you have been taught to believe. Your dreams mater. Your personal pursuit of happiness matters. You matter. My intention in writing this book was to speak to the miracle that is you. Author Biography:

Louis Alan Swartz has devoted his life to helping people realize the magnitude of their ability. He has traveled extensively in Africa, India, Europe, and the Middle East. He lives in Los Angeles with Connie, his wife of thirty years.
